ABSTRACT

BACKGROUND: A smooth and rapid recovery from anesthesia allowing safe release is desirable, especially for wild species. This study describes the clinical effects of the combination of dexmedetomidine and ketamine and the partial reversal with atipamezole in golden-headed lion tamarins. METHODS: Dexmedetomidine 10 µg kg-1 and ketamine 15 mg kg-1 were administered to 45 golden-headed lion tamarins undergoing vasectomy. Following surgery, animals were assigned to three groups: control (SAL; 0.9% NaCl), atipamezole 20 µg kg-1 (ATI20), and atipamezole 40 µg kg-1 (ATI40). RESULTS AND CONCLUSIONS: All animals presented great scores of sedation and muscle relaxation during the procedure. Recovery in the control group was smooth and uneventful. Salivation, muscle tremors, and head movements were observed in ATI 20 and ATI40. The administration of atipamezole did not change total recovery times (ATI20 69 ± 23 minutes; ATI40 72 ± 45 minutes; SAL 57 ± 23 minutes).

ABSTRACT

BACKGROUND: The golden-headed lion tamarin (Leontopithecus chrysomelas), originally endemic to Bahia, was introduced in Rio de Janeiro. The species is currently found in remaining forests within the region of original occupation of the golden lion tamarin (Leontopithecus rosalia), which may compromise the survival of the golden lion tamarin. Groups of golden-headed lion tamarins were captured and translocated to Bahia. However, the area chosen reached its limit and males underwent to vasectomy procedures. METHODS: Animals were separated into 3 groups: S-ketamine and midazolam, S-ketamine and dexmedetomidine, and racemic ketamine and dexmedetomidine. RESULTS AND CONCLUSIONS: Heart rate, sedation and muscle relaxation degrees, antinociception, and lidocaine consumption presented significant difference between midazolam and dexmedetomidine groups. Bradycardia was present on dexmedetomidine groups, with values remaining within the normal range. Dexmedetomidine groups present the best outcomes for muscle relaxation, sedation, and antinociception and were safe for vasectomy surgery in golden-headed lion tamarins.
